🎙️ Crumb Confessional — Episode 33f
Title: Squirrels Might Have Schedules
Description:
This was recorded the same day as Episode 33e—still at French Park, still walking, still stirred up. I ended up bumping into Yost again while out on the trail and we just kept talking. The conversation drifted from internet toxicity to neighborhood apps, turtle biology, snapping turtle sightings, and this sudden theory I had about squirrels running on daily rhythms. I wasn’t with my kids—just crossing paths with other families, swapping creek stories and turtle facts.
